I was interested in the plugin: Taxonomy Chain Menu, which I found in the GIFT folder of the Husky Plugin.
I bought Husky from codecanyon. Installed v3.3.4.4

I found in the GIFT folder the version of Taxonomy Chain Menu. I've read It's the Premium version.

However, once installed it is incompatible with my version of WooCommerce v.9.3.3.

screenshot

there is a solution?

Hello

Please add in index.php  this code:

add_action('before_woocommerce_init', function () {
if (class_exists('\Automattic\WooCommerce\Utilities\FeaturesUtil')) {
\Automattic\WooCommerce\Utilities\FeaturesUtil::declare_compatibility('custom_order_tables', __FILE__, true);
}
});
